Output dd70edc81fd359d69d539fd51c25081011040386d03f4661fffb715a69fceaf5:0

value
1213491
script pubkey
OP_0 OP_PUSHBYTES_20 7346a839665137ad501aa2eac94304fa6cde3c9d
address
bc1qwdr2swtx2ym665q65t4vjscylfkdu0yay86wmw
transaction
dd70edc81fd359d69d539fd51c25081011040386d03f4661fffb715a69fceaf5
confirmations
211919
spent
true